BioShock Returns? 2K Prepping a Major Reveal
BioShock fans may finally get what they’ve been waiting for. According to new reports, 2K is preparing a major announcement tied to the beloved franchise—and it’s expected to arrive before the end of summer 2025.
Leaker Kurakasis, known for early trademark and domain discoveries, suggests that the mysterious reveal will heavily feature Rapture—the eerie underwater city from the original BioShock games. However, it’s unclear if this announcement is for a full remake, a remaster, or the long-rumored BioShock 4.
What Might Be Announced?
There are three major theories:
- BioShock Remake or Remaster: Though a remastered collection is already available, a full remake would modernize the experience for today’s players.
- BioShock 4 Reveal: Announced in 2019, development on BioShock 4 has faced delays. Rumors suggest it takes place in an arctic city tied to Rapture’s legacy.
- BioShock Netflix Movie: While this could also be the subject, director Francis Lawrence’s current film commitments make a trailer or footage unlikely this year.
Given the speculation and timing, Summer Game Fest 2025 seems the most likely venue for this big reveal. The annual event regularly features surprise trailers and world premieres.
Rapture Resurfaces
Whether it’s a return to the original BioShock or a bold new chapter, it seems Rapture will once again take center stage. The original 2007 game captivated audiences with its haunting setting and moral dilemmas, and this legacy may play a big part in the marketing for whatever is coming next.
Despite reports of BioShock 4’s development hell last year, the hiring of 30 new developers hinted that progress was still underway. With GTA 6 now delayed, 2K could be eyeing BioShock as a major Q4 release to fill the gap, possibly targeting Halloween 2025.
